body {
	margin:0 auto; overflow-x: hidden; font: 12px/1.67 "Microsoft Yahei",sans-serif; background-color:#FBFBFB;
}

body,td,th {
	font-family: Microsoft Yahei;
	font-size: 12px;
	color: #606060;
}

a {
	font-family: ËÎÌå;
	font-size: 12px;
	color: #606060;
}
a:link {
	text-decoration: none;
	color: #606060;
}
a:visited {
	text-decoration: none;
	color: #606060;
}
a:hover {
	text-decoration: underline;
	color: #FF6600;
}
a:active {
	text-decoration: none;
	color: #FF6600;
}


H1 {
	PADDING-BOTTOM: 0px; MARGIN: 0px; PADDING-LEFT: 0px; PADDING-RIGHT: 0px; CURSOR: default; FONT-WEIGHT: normal; PADDING-TOP: 0px
}
H2 {
	PADDING-BOTTOM: 0px; MARGIN: 0px; PADDING-LEFT: 0px; PADDING-RIGHT: 0px; CURSOR: default; FONT-WEIGHT: normal; PADDING-TOP: 0px
}
H3 {
	PADDING-BOTTOM: 0px; MARGIN: 0px; PADDING-LEFT: 0px; PADDING-RIGHT: 0px; CURSOR: default; FONT-WEIGHT: normal; PADDING-TOP: 0px
}
H4 {
	PADDING-BOTTOM: 0px; MARGIN: 0px; PADDING-LEFT: 0px; PADDING-RIGHT: 0px; CURSOR: default; FONT-WEIGHT: normal; PADDING-TOP: 0px
}
P {
	PADDING-BOTTOM: 0px; MARGIN: 0px; PADDING-LEFT: 0px; PADDING-RIGHT: 0px; CURSOR: default; FONT-WEIGHT: normal; PADDING-TOP: 0px
}
UL {
	PADDING-BOTTOM: 0px; MARGIN: 0px; PADDING-LEFT: 0px; PADDING-RIGHT: 0px; CURSOR: default; FONT-WEIGHT: normal; PADDING-TOP: 0px
}
OL {
	PADDING-BOTTOM: 0px; MARGIN: 0px; PADDING-LEFT: 0px; PADDING-RIGHT: 0px; CURSOR: default; FONT-WEIGHT: normal; PADDING-TOP: 0px
}
DD {
	PADDING-BOTTOM: 0px; MARGIN: 0px; PADDING-LEFT: 0px; PADDING-RIGHT: 0px; CURSOR: default; FONT-WEIGHT: normal; PADDING-TOP: 0px
}
DL {
	PADDING-BOTTOM: 0px; MARGIN: 0px; PADDING-LEFT: 0px; PADDING-RIGHT: 0px; CURSOR: default; FONT-WEIGHT: normal; PADDING-TOP: 0px
}

UL {
	LIST-STYLE-TYPE: none; PADDING-LEFT: 0px
}

IMG {
	BORDER-BOTTOM: 0px; BORDER-LEFT: 0px; BORDER-TOP: 0px; BORDER-RIGHT: 0px
}
I {
	FONT-STYLE: normal; TEXT-DECORATION: none
}
S {
	FONT-STYLE: normal; TEXT-DECORATION: none
}
EM {
	FONT-STYLE: normal; TEXT-DECORATION: none
}
U {
	FONT-STYLE: normal; TEXT-DECORATION: none
}
.wrap {
	WIDTH: 1000px; MARGIN-LEFT: auto; MARGIN-RIGHT: auto
}
.l {
	FLOAT: left
}
.r {
	FLOAT: right !important
}
.pr {
	POSITION: relative
}
.pa {
	POSITION: absolute
}
.tc {
	TEXT-ALIGN: center
}
.tr {
	TEXT-ALIGN: right
}
.tl {
	TEXT-ALIGN: left
}
.vm {
	VERTICAL-ALIGN: middle
}
.vt {
	VERTICAL-ALIGN: top
}
.vb {
	VERTICAL-ALIGN: bottom
}
.db {
	DISPLAY: block
}
.dib {
	DISPLAY: inline-block; -moz-inline-stack: inline-block
}

.el {
	TEXT-OVERFLOW: ellipsis; WHITE-SPACE: nowrap; OVERFLOW: hidden
}
.art_link A {
	TEXT-OVERFLOW: ellipsis; WHITE-SPACE: nowrap; OVERFLOW: hidden
}
.oh {
	OVERFLOW: hidden
}
.mh {
	MIN-HEIGHT: 364px; HEIGHT: auto !important
}
.btn {
	CURSOR: pointer
}
.hidetext {
	FONT: 0px/0 a; LETTER-SPACING: -9px
}
.cir {
	WIDTH: 0px; DISPLAY: inline-block; HEIGHT: 0px; OVERFLOW: hidden
}
.bor1 {
	BORDER-BOTTOM: #ddd 1px solid; BORDER-LEFT: #ddd 1px solid; BORDER-TOP: #ddd 1px solid; BORDER-RIGHT: #ddd 1px solid
}
.bor1_b {
	BORDER-BOTTOM: #ddd 1px solid
}
.bor1_b_s {
	BORDER-BOTTOM: #ababab 1px dotted
}
.red {
	COLOR: #e60013 !important
}
.grey {
	BACKGROUND: #ededed
}

.line {
	MARGIN: 0px 12px; WIDTH: 1px; DISPLAY: inline-block; BACKGROUND: url(../images/ico.png) no-repeat -99px -64px; HEIGHT: 14px; VERTICAL-ALIGN: middle; OVERFLOW: hidden
}
.bwhite {
	BACKGROUND: #fff
}
.hide {
	DISPLAY: none
}
.slide {
	POSITION: relative; WIDTH: 100%
}


.banner {
	HEIGHT: 400px; _margin-top: -1px
}
.banner .ban_c IMG {
	POSITION: absolute; WIDTH: 1920px; MARGIN-LEFT: -960px; TOP: 0px; LEFT: 50%
}
.banner .ban_nav {
	DISPLAY: none
}
.banner .ban_t {
	PADDING-BOTTOM: 20px; TEXT-INDENT: 0px; PADDING-LEFT: 20px; WIDTH: 248px; BOTTOM: 105px; PADDING-RIGHT: 20px; WHITE-SPACE: normal; COLOR: #fff; MARGIN-LEFT: -493px; PADDING-TOP: 20px; LEFT: 50%
}
.banner .ban_t .t {
	LINE-HEIGHT: 1.4; COLOR: #fff; FONT-SIZE: 30px; FONT-WEIGHT: bold
}
.banner .link {
	Z-INDEX: 9; POSITION: absolute; PADDING-BOTTOM: 5px; TEXT-INDENT: 12px; PADDING-LEFT: 0px; WIDTH: 288px; BOTTOM: 0px; PADDING-RIGHT: 0px; DISPLAY: none; BACKGROUND: #eb0007; COLOR: #fff; MARGIN-LEFT: -493px; PADDING-TOP: 5px; LEFT: 50%
}
.banner .link EM {
	PADDING-RIGHT: 8px; FLOAT: right; _margin: 3px 0 0; _padding-right: 4px
}
.banner .link .cir {
	BORDER-BOTTOM: transparent 4px dashed; BORDER-LEFT: #fff 4px solid; MARGIN-LEFT: 4px; VERTICAL-ALIGN: 1px; BORDER-TOP: transparent 4px dashed; BORDER-RIGHT: transparent 4px dashed
}
.banner .Left {
	POSITION: absolute; WIDTH: 38px; BOTTOM: 15px; BACKGROUND: url(../images/cir_white.gif) #aaa no-repeat; HEIGHT: 38px; RIGHT: 50%
}
.banner .Right {
	POSITION: absolute; WIDTH: 38px; BOTTOM: 15px; BACKGROUND: url(../images/cir_white.gif) #aaa no-repeat; HEIGHT: 38px; RIGHT: 50%
}
.banner .Left {
	BACKGROUND-POSITION: 5px 0px; MARGIN-RIGHT: -450px
}
.banner .Right {
	BACKGROUND-COLOR: #0093DD; BACKGROUND-POSITION: -33px 0px; MARGIN-RIGHT: -490px
}
.bann_ext {
	POSITION: relative;
}
.frontCover {
	BORDER-BOTTOM: #0093DD 5px solid; POSITION: absolute; PADDING-BOTTOM: 16px; PADDING-LEFT: 0px; PADDING-RIGHT: 0px; TOP: -97px; PADDING-TOP: 0px
}
.frontCover LI {
	PADDING-BOTTOM: 3px; PADDING-LEFT: 3px; WIDTH: 82px; PADDING-RIGHT: 3px; BACKGROUND: #FF6600; FLOAT: left; COLOR: #fff; OVERFLOW: hidden; CURSOR: pointer; MARGIN-RIGHT: 10px; PADDING-TOP: 3px
}
.frontCover P {
	TEXT-ALIGN: center
}
.frontCover .img {
	POSITION: relative; HEIGHT: 50px; OVERFLOW: hidden
}
.frontCover IMG {
	POSITION: absolute; WIDTH: 192px; HEIGHT: 50px; LEFT: -50px
}
.frontCover .open {
	BACKGROUND: #0093DD
}
.bann_ext_bord {
	WIDTH: 1000px; PADDING-TOP: 10px
}
.bann_ext_bord H2 {
	FLOAT: left; COLOR: #333; FONT-SIZE: 16px; FONT-WEIGHT: bold; MARGIN-RIGHT: 10px
}

.bann_ext_list {
	MARGIN-TOP: 5px; COLOR: #ddd; CLEAR: left; BORDER-TOP: #ddd 1px solid; PADDING-TOP: 10px
}
.bann_ext_list A {
	COLOR: #333
}
.bann_ext_list .dib {
	LINE-HEIGHT: 20px; MARGIN: 0px 0.5em
}
.bann_ext_list A:hover {
	COLOR: #999
}


.menu {font-size:15px; padding-left:25px; padding-right:25px; color:#FFF; font-family:"Î¢ÈíÑÅºÚ"; font-weight:900;}
a.menu:link {text-decoration:none;color:#FFF;}
a.menu:visited {text-decoration:none;color:#FFF;}
a.menu:hover {text-decoration:none;color:#FF6600;}

.cp_menu{ font-family:"Microsoft YaHei";}
.cp_menu ul li{ background:url(../images/m_01.jpg); height:37px; line-height:37px; text-indent:40px; margin-top:4px; font-size:15px;}
.cp_menu ul li a:link{ display:block;_display:inline-block; color:#000000; width:230px;_width:160px;font-family: "Microsoft YaHei";font-size:15px; text-decoration: none;}
.cp_menu ul li a:visited{ display:block;_display:inline-block; color:#000000; width:230px;_width:160px;font-family: "Microsoft YaHei"; font-size:15px;text-decoration: none; }
.cp_menu ul li a:hover{display:block; _display:inline-block; background:url(../images/m_02.jpg);color:#ffffff; width:230px;_width:160px;font-family: "Microsoft YaHei";_background:;}
.cp_menu ul li a:active{ display:block;_display:inline-block; color:#ffffff; width:230px;_width:160px;}

.index_img{
	width: 150px;
	height: 200px;
	border: 1px solid #E0E0E0;
	padding:2px;
	margin: 0px 5px 0px 5px;
}

.ind_case_img{
	width: 187px;
	height: 130px;
	border: 1px solid #E0E0E0;
	padding:3px;
	margin: 0px 5px 0px 5px;
}

.cp_img{
	width: 195px;
	height: 260px;
	border: 1px solid #E0E0E0;
	padding:3px;
}

.case_img{
	width: 230px;
	height: 160px;
	border: 1px solid #E0E0E0;
	padding:3px;
}

.big_img{
	border: 3px solid #E0E0E0;
	padding:2px;
}


.cp_name {font-family:"Microsoft YaHei"; font-size:13px;}
a.cp_name:link {text-decoration:none;color:#606060;}
a.cp_name:visited {text-decoration:none;color:#606060;}
a.cp_name:hover {text-decoration:none;color:#FF6600;}



.content{font-family:"Microsoft YaHei";font-size:14px; line-height:26px; padding-top:10px;}

.scsb{ vertical-align:middle; width: 200px; height:150px; border: 1px solid #DEDEDE; padding:3px; margin-left:25px; margin-right:25px; margin-top:10px; margin-bottom:10px;}

.news_tit {font-family:"Microsoft YaHei"; font-size:13px;}
a.news_tit:link {text-decoration:none;color:#606060;}
a.news_tit:visited {text-decoration:none;color:#606060;}
a.news_tit:hover {text-decoration:none;color:#FF6600;}

.qt_bot_menu {font-size:14px; padding-left:15px; padding-right:15px; color:#E3EDEE; font-family:"Î¢ÈíÑÅºÚ";}
a.qt_bot_menu:link {text-decoration:none;color:#E3EDEE;}
a.qt_bot_menu:visited {text-decoration:none;color:#E3EDEE;}
a.qt_bot_menu:hover {text-decoration:none;color:#FF6600;}